Transaction 81d28da9a7e5ebc5f41edda8913a373be4701912e7e43a3cbd248487a2eabe21
1 Input
1 Output
-
81d28da9a7e5ebc5f41edda8913a373be4701912e7e43a3cbd248487a2eabe21:0
- value
- 258286
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c89e8cdf359e96a132235c7472f7d8bdcd557f8
- address
- bc1qdjy73n0nt85k5yezxhr5wtma30wd24lcuclk64